How to treat vaginal candidal infection?

Patients with candidal vaginitis can take ketoconazole orally, and use Western medicines such as gentian violet and clotrimazole vaginal suppositories for external treatment. They can also choose microwave treatment and flush the vagina with soda water to change the pH of the vagina and relieve the condition. They can also use Chinese medicine prescriptions for syndrome differentiation treatment, or use Chinese medicine fumigation, washing and sitting baths to relieve the condition.

1. Western medicine treatment of fungal vaginitis

1. Medication

1 Oral medication

When suffering from this disease, you can take oral drugs such as ketoconazole, clotrimazole, and trichostatin to kill bacteria and relieve itching, which can effectively relieve the condition.

2. Topical medications

Patients can also effectively relieve the condition by applying some topical medications directly to the affected area. For example, applying gentian violet and disinfectant gel locally and placing clotrimazole vaginal suppositories in the vagina can clear away heat and dampness, dispel wind and relieve itching, which helps relieve the condition.

2. Microwave therapy

Since microwave therapy can improve local blood circulation, enhance metabolism, and facilitate the regeneration and repair of damaged tissues, there are certain benefits for patients to choose microwave therapy.

3. Rinse your vagina with soda water

Mold likes to reproduce and grow in an acidic environment. When you suffer from this disease, you can rinse your vagina with baking soda water to change the pH value of the vagina. When the living environment of mold is destroyed, the disease can be alleviated.
